ANNA OXYGEN
This Is An Exercise
Kill Rock Stars
· This CD passed through a couple of pairs of hands before it got to me, and I was determined to better the others by actually getting through the whole thing. How hard of a listen could it be? Anna Oxygen are on the same label as The Gossip and Deerhoof.
I would recommend this CD to only the most hardcore of Yaz fans who think that Yaz could only be improved by lazier sequencing and less interesting vocals.
"Psychic Rainbow" and "Walk," the only tracks that have potential hooks, they are spoiled by boring arrangements and performances that sound dry and uninspired (something that plagues the whole album).
In almost every song, the tracks sound like theyre slightly out of sync, and some of the frequencies border on annoying. Overall, the production was tasteless and missing the mark dance records are supposed to be exciting and tight. This, unfortunately, necessitates good production.
If this album is supposed to be new age, then Anna Oxygen might want to lose the vocoder and kitschy esthetic. At the end of the day, I think This Is An Exercise might have worked as a psychedelic dance album if it wasnt so flat and lifeless.
